How it works
How it works
How it works
The Star Catcher Network is comprised of Power Nodes that collect, concentrate, refine, and distribute power to client satellites anywhere in Low Earth Orbit and beyond.

Energy Source
The Sun is a near-limitless fusion reactor whose light, though abundant, arrives scattered and low-powered.

Collection & Concentration
Star Catcher Power Nodes collect diffuse sunlight with lightweight, low-cost Fresnel lenses to direct and concentrate it.

Refinement
The light is then refined into wavelengths tuned for maximum transmission and conversion efficiency on existing satellite solar panels.

Tracking & Distribution
Precision tracking systems control adaptive mirrors capable of beaming light to 50 satellites at once, ensuring every photon reaches its intended destination.

Delivery & Use
With no retrofit required, satellites can generate up to 10x more power on demand, enabling more uptime, supercharged missions, and next-gen capabilities.
